Abstract

The utility model belongs to the technical field of lighting equipment, and particularly relates to an LED light source assembly and an LED lamp. The LED light source assembly comprises an LED light source and a connector, the LED light source comprises a substrate and an LED structure, the substrate is provided with a mounting hole, the connector comprises a body and an elastic body, the body comprises an insertion part extending along an axis X and a head part connected to one end of the insertion part, the insertion part comprises an insertion main body and at least two groups of clamping hook structures, and the clamping hook structures are arranged on the insertion main body and spaced from the head part. The plugging main body penetrates through the elastic body and the mounting hole, the elastic body and the substrate are clamped between the head part and one group of clamping hook structures close to the head part, so that the connector is jointed with the substrate, and at least another group of clamping hook structures far away from the head part is suspended. By the adoption of the technical scheme, the problem that a screw used for locking the LED light source is prone to being lost is solved, it is ensured that the connector and the LED light source are always kept in a joint state, the connector can be used immediately after being taken, and the production efficiency of assembling and producing an LED lamp is improved.

[0001] This application belongs to the field of lighting equipment technology, and in particular relates to an LED light source component and an LED lamp. Background Technology

[0002] Currently, LED light sources are secured to supporting components with screws; for example, the LED light source is directly secured to the inner wall of the lamp housing with screws. However, before installation or after removal, the screw is a separate component detached from the LED light source and supporting components, making it easy to lose. Utility Model Content

[0003] The purpose of this application is to provide an LED light source assembly and an LED lamp, which aims to solve the problem that screws used to lock the LED light source are easily lost.

[0036] According to a first aspect of this application, an LED light source assembly 100 is provided. According to a second aspect of this application, an LED luminaire 200 is provided.

[0037] like Figures 1 to 4As shown, the LED light source assembly 100 provided in the embodiment of this application includes an LED light source 20 and a connector 30. The LED light source 20 includes a substrate 21 and an LED structure 22 disposed on the substrate 21. The substrate 21 is provided with a mounting hole 211. The connector 30 includes a body 31 and an elastic body 32. The body 31 includes a plug-in portion 311 and a head 312. The plug-in portion 311 extends along an axis X perpendicular to the substrate 21. The head 312 is connected to one end of the plug-in portion 311. The plug-in portion 311 includes a plug-in body 3111 and at least two sets of hook structures 3114. At least two sets of hook structures 3114 are disposed on the plug-in body 3111, and adjacent sets of hook structures 3114 are spaced apart. The set of hook structures 3114 near the head 312 is spaced apart from the head 312. The insertion body 3111 passes through the elastic body 32 and the mounting hole 211. The elastic body 32 and the substrate 21 are clamped between the head 312 and a set of hook structures 3114 near the head 312, so that the connector 30 engages with the substrate 21, and the LED light source 20 and the connector 30 are assembled into a modular structure. Furthermore, at least one other set of hook structures 3114 away from the head 312 is suspended, so that at least one other set of hook structures 3114 away from the head 312 can be used to connect to the support member 40 to assemble into an LED lamp 200.

[0038] And, as Figure 5 and Figure 6 As shown, the LED lamp 200 provided in the embodiment of this application includes a support member 40 and an LED light source assembly 100 as described above. The support member 40 is provided with an assembly hole 41. At least another set of hook structures 3114 of the connector 30 of the LED light source assembly 100, which is away from the head 312, passes through the assembly hole 41 and hooks onto the support member 40, so that the LED light source assembly 100 and the support member 40 are joined and assembled into the LED lamp 200.

[0039] The LED light source assembly 100 of this application uses a connector 30 to lock and install the LED light source 20. The connector 30 includes a body 31 and an elastic body 32. The body 31 consists of a plug-in portion 311 and a head 312. The plug-in portion 311 includes a plug-in main body 3111 and at least two sets of hook structures 3114 disposed on the plug-in main body 3111. The plug-in main body 3111 passes through the mounting holes 211 of the elastic body 32 and the substrate 21, so that the elastic body 32 and the substrate 21 are clamped between the head 312 and a set of hook structures 3114 near the head 312. This allows the connector 30 to engage with the substrate 21, i.e., the LED light source 20 and the connector 30 are assembled into a modular structure, effectively preventing the connector 30 from being lost. Furthermore, at least one other set of hook structures 3114, away from the head 312, is suspended to lock the LED light source assembly 100 as a whole onto the support member 40 for assembly into an LED lamp 200. In this way, the LED light source assembly 100, which is assembled into a modular structure, can ensure that the connector 30 and the LED light source 20 are always in a connected state, and can be used immediately, thereby improving the production efficiency of assembling and producing LED lamps 200.

[0040] In the LED light source assembly 100 provided in the embodiments of this application, such as Figure 3 and Figure 4 As shown, the LED structure 22 and at least one other set of latching structures 3114, located away from the head 312, are respectively located on both sides of the substrate 21. Thus, when the LED light source assembly 100 is integrally locked onto the support member 40 to assemble the LED lamp 200, the LED structure 22 of the LED light source 20 is located on the side of the substrate 21 facing away from the support member 40. This allows the side of the substrate 21 facing the support member 40 to be as close as possible to the support member 40, preferably with the substrate 21 abutting against the support member 40, at which point the elastic body 32 is clamped between the head 312 and the substrate 21. Therefore, when the LED structure 22 emits light, the heat generated by the LED structure 22 is transferred through the substrate 21 to the support member 40, and then dissipated through the support member 40, thereby contributing to the overall heat dissipation and cooling of the LED light source 20 and effectively preventing abnormal temperature rise of the LED light source 20. [0045] like Figures 1 to 4 As shown, the LED light source assembly 100 provided in the embodiments of this application includes a first elastic arm 3112 and a second elastic arm 3113, both of which have elastic deformation capability. Furthermore, as... Figures 1 to 4 As shown, each set of hook structures 3114 includes a first hook 3115 and a second hook 3116. The first hook 3115 of each set of hook structures 3114 is disposed on the first spring arm 3112, and the second hook 3116 of each set of hook structures 3114 is disposed on the second spring arm 3113. The first hook 3115 and the second hook 3116 of the same set extend away from each other. When the insertion body 3111 is inserted into the mounting hole 211 of the elastic body 32 and the substrate 21, the first spring arm 3112 and the second spring arm 3113 are squeezed, so that the first spring arm 3112 and the second spring arm 3113 move closer to each other, so that the distance between the end of the first hook 3115 and the end of the second hook 3116 of each set of hook structures 3114 becomes smaller, so that each set of hook structures 3114 can pass smoothly through the through hole of the elastic body 32 and the mounting hole 211 of the substrate 21. Then, the first elastic arm 3112 and the second elastic arm 3113 are released. Under their respective elastic forces, the first elastic arm 3112 and the second elastic arm 3113 move away from each other until they return to their unelastic deformation state. At this time, the first hook 3115 and the second hook 3116 of a set of hook structures 3114 near the head 312 hook the elastic body 32, so that the connector 30 is joined to the substrate 21, and the LED light source 20 and the connector 30 are assembled into a modular structure.

[0046] Furthermore, the insertion body 3111 is further inserted into the mounting hole 41 of the support member 40. At this time, the first elastic arm 3112 and the second elastic arm 3113 are squeezed by the hole wall of the mounting hole 41 and move closer to each other until at least another set of hook structures 3114 away from the head 312 passes through the mounting hole 41. When at least another set of hook structures 3114 away from the head 312 passes through the mounting hole 41, the first elastic arm 3112 and the second elastic arm 3113 move away from each other under their respective elastic forces until they return to a state without elastic deformation. Then, the first hook 3115 and the second hook 3116 of the at least another set of hook structures 3114 away from the head 312 hook onto the support member 40, so that the LED light source assembly 100 and the support member 40 are joined and assembled into an LED lamp 200. Furthermore, the support member 40, the substrate 21, the elastomer 32, and the head 312 are sequentially stacked and compressed along the extension direction of the axis X. Since the elastomer 32 has elastic deformation capability, the elastomer 32 is compressed, thereby absorbing the assembly tolerances of the hook structure 3114, the support member 40, the substrate 21, the elastomer 32, and the head 312 along the extension direction of the axis X, so as to complete the installation work more reliably.

[0047] In the connector of the LED light source assembly 100 of this application, the latching structures 3114 are in two sets spaced apart. One set of latching structures 3114 is close to and spaced apart from the head 312, while the other set of latching structures 3114 is away from the head 312 and is used to connect to the support member 40. Furthermore, as... Figure 2 As shown, in the set of hook structures 3114 near the head 312, the distance between the end of the first hook 3115 and the end of the second hook 3116 is L1, and in at least another set of hook structures 3114 away from the head 312, the distance between the end of the first hook 3115 and the end of the second hook 3116 is L2, where L1 ≥ L2. Furthermore, as... Figure 6 As shown, in the LED lamp 200 provided in the embodiment of this application, the support member 40 is further provided with a groove 42 recessed away from the LED light source 20. The mounting hole 41 is provided at the bottom of the groove 42. A set of hook structures 3114 near the head 312 are at least partially accommodated in the groove 42, and the substrate 21 abuts against the support member 40 and compresses the elastic body 32. That is, the groove diameter of the groove 42 is greater than L1, L1 is greater than the diameter of the mounting hole 211, the diameter of the mounting hole 211 is smaller than the outer diameter of the elastic body 32, and L2 is greater than the diameter of the mounting hole 41.

[0048] In the embodiments of this application, the body 31 of the connector 30 is a one-piece molded component. Further, the body of the connector 30 can be a component integrally molded from metal material using a stamping process, or it can be a component integrally molded from plastic using an injection molding process. And the elastomer 32 is one of a rubber pad, a silicone pad, or a coil spring.
